Product Category Manager


Super Bright LEDs is seeking a Product Category Manager to lead the strategy, development, and performance of our LED lighting product categories on our e-commerce platform. This role focuses on retail category management and requires a strong understanding of eCommerce merchandising, product lifecycle planning, and market-driven decision-making.

The ideal candidate will bring a solid foundation in product and market analysis, pricing strategy, and supplier management to build and maintain a compelling, customer-focused product assortment. This position plays a key role in optimizing category performance, enhancing online customer experience, and driving profitable growth through effective merchandising and strategic product planning.

Note: This position comes with different weekly schedule options that include a choice in the number of hours worked per day to benefit from up-to a three-day weekend, a choice in offered daily start times, and other beneficial options regarding lunch breaks. This is an in-office position. Working at our office in Earth City, Missouri, is needed.

Key Responsibilities:

Market Competition & Strategy

  • Conduct ongoing competitive analysis across e-commerce and retail channels to monitor market trends, benchmark product offerings, and identify opportunities for category expansion and differentiation
  • Recommend new products, merchandising strategies, and promotional approaches that align with customer demand and support profitable category growth
  • Develop and implement competitive pricing strategies that drive online conversion and maintain healthy margins, while minimizing cannibalization across related product categories
  • Use insights from sales data, customer behavior, and competitor activity to continuously refine category strategy and positioning
Supplier & Product Development
  • Collaborate with sourcing and procurement teams to identify and evaluate new suppliers and product opportunities that enhance category depth and competitiveness within the e-commerce marketplace
  • Ensure supplier capabilities meet quality, compliance, and fulfillment standards critical to supporting online retail operations
  • Negotiate product costs, minimum order quantities, and lead times to maximize margin performance and inventory efficiency
  • Define initial stocking strategies and order quantities using sales performance data, customer demand trends, and category benchmarks to support effective merchandising and minimize excess inventory
E-Commerce Merchandising
  • Develop product briefs and collaborate with the Web Content and Creative teams to create accurate, engaging, and conversion-focused product listings that reflect retail category strategy
  • Ensure product titles, specifications, images, videos, filters, and cross-sell opportunities (e.g., products and accessories frequently bought together) are optimized to support discoverability, customer decision-making, and the overall online shopping experience
  • Partner with the marketing team to align product positioning, promotions, and seasonal campaigns with category goals and customer demand
  • Continuously review on-site merchandising performance to identify opportunities for improvement and ensure consistent execution of the brand and category strategy across the company's e-commerce platform
Category Performance & Lifecycle Management
  • Own the end-to-end performance of assigned product categories by monitoring and analyzing key metrics such as sales, profit margins, conversion rates, and inventory turnover across the e-commerce platform
  • Identify actionable growth drivers - including pricing strategies, promotional effectiveness, product attributes, and customer engagement - to optimize category performance and profitability
  • Evaluate the success of new product launches using sales and site performance data, recommending adjustments to content, pricing, or assortment based on early insights
  • Manage the full product lifecycle by identifying and addressing underperforming SKUs, analyzing returns and customer feedback, and making informed decisions on product repositioning or discontinuation
Relationships & Collaboration
  • Build and maintain strong supplier relationships to support competitive pricing, reliable inventory availability, and the introduction of innovative, high-demand products that strengthen category performance within our e-commerce platform
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with sourcing, marketing, operations, and web content teams to ensure cohesive execution of category strategies, from product onboarding and merchandising to promotions and fulfillment
  • Serve as the key category owner, ensuring alignment across departments to drive sales, improve customer experience, and support overall business objectives
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in business administration, marketing, or a related field
  • 2-3 years of experience in retail category or buyer management, and/or e-commerce category management and merchandising
  • Experience in the LED lighting industry or in managing technical product categories is essential
  • Demonstrated ability to analyze complex data sets and translate insights into actionable category strategies
  • Proven project management skills, with the ability to prioritize and execute multiple initiatives in a fast-paced environment
  • Experience with web platforms or tools (e.g., content management systems, e-commerce platforms); familiarity with NetSuite or web design concepts is considered an asset
